If you are a student from outside the UK who wants to study there, you must get a student visa. The rules and guidelines for student visas are constantly changing, so it’s important to keep up with them to ensure you have the correct visa for your studies. In this article, we’ll talk about the new rules for UK student visas. The new rules are as follows:

Points-Based System

The UK has a Points-Based System for student visas. This system evaluates applicants based on their qualifications, their language skills, and how much money they have for living expenses. 

English language skills

You must have a certain level of English skills, usually shown by a secure English language test like IELTS. 

Financial support

You must have enough money to take care of yourself without working or getting help from the government. This could mean showing proof of money, like a bank statement or a letter from a sponsor. 

Background checks

The UK government has added more security and background checks for people who want to get a student visa. This includes looking at your criminal record and ensuring you are not a threat. 

Sponsorship

You must have a licensed Tier 4 sponsor, like a university or college, to pay for your visa. 

Biometric information

As part of your visa application, you have to give biometric information, such as your fingerprints and a digital photo.
